Early Life and Career

P.T. Barnum's journey to fame began in his early years. He was born to a modest family, and financial struggles were a constant reality. At the age of 15, Barnum started working to support his family, but he never lost sight of his dream to entertain. His first venture into the entertainment industry was as a lottery manager, where he developed his skills in promotion and publicity.

In 1835, Barnum purchased a slave named Joice Heth, claiming she was the 161-year-old nurse of George Washington. This venture was controversial but immensely popular, showcasing Barnum's ability to exploit public curiosity. His success with Heth set the stage for more ambitious projects.

The Showman Emerges

By the late 1830s, Barnum had firmly established himself as a showman. He created the American Museum in New York City, which featured an array of oddities, curiosities, and live performances. This museum became a cultural landmark, drawing thousands of visitors eager to see the bizarre and unusual.

Some of the most notable attractions included the "Feejee Mermaid," a fabricated creature that combined a fish and a monkey, and the "General Tom Thumb," a little person who became a star in his own right. Barnum's knack for creating sensational stories around his exhibits captivated the public and solidified his reputation as a master showman.

The Barnum & Bailey Circus

In 1871, Barnum joined forces with James Bailey to create the "Greatest Show on Earth" – the Barnum & Bailey Circus. This partnership revolutionized the circus industry by combining various acts, including acrobats, clowns, and animal performances, into a cohesive spectacle. The circus quickly gained fame and became a staple of American entertainment.

One of the key innovations of the Barnum & Bailey Circus was the use of elaborate marketing techniques. Barnum understood the importance of publicity and utilized colorful posters, catchy slogans, and even parades to promote the circus. His efforts paid off, and the circus became a national sensation, touring across the United States and drawing massive crowds.

Controversies and Criticism

Despite his success, Barnum's career was not without controversy. Critics have pointed out that some of his exhibits exploited marginalized individuals, and his use of deception in marketing raised ethical questions. While Barnum argued that he was providing entertainment and education, many believe that he perpetuated stereotypes and commodified human lives.

Furthermore, the treatment of animals in circuses has come under scrutiny in recent years, leading to protests and calls for reform. Barnum's legacy is thus a complex one, as it encompasses both innovation and ethical dilemmas.
